Key Highlights
- Sanju Samson scored 97 runs off 50 balls in the match against West Indies.
- India chased down a target of 196 runs, finishing at 199/5 in 19.2 overs.
- Samson's innings included twelve boundaries and four sixes.
- This victory secured India's place in the T20 World Cup semifinals.
- Samson broke the previous record for the highest score by an Indian in a World Cup run chase.
